From c2c6e99878853fafdbd5e708c3163921f8529ae1 Mon Sep 17 00:00:00 2001 From: Pitu <7425261+Pitu@users.noreply.github.com> Date: Mon, 17 Sep 2018 04:38:25 -0300 Subject: Public albums wooo! --- src/site/views/PublicAlbum.vue | 105 ++++++++++++++++++++++++++++++++++++ src/site/views/dashboard/Albums.vue | 24 +++++---- 2 files changed, 120 insertions(+), 9 deletions(-) create mode 100644 src/site/views/PublicAlbum.vue (limited to 'src/site/views') diff --git a/src/site/views/PublicAlbum.vue b/src/site/views/PublicAlbum.vue new file mode 100644 index 0000000..534c185 --- /dev/null +++ b/src/site/views/PublicAlbum.vue @@ -0,0 +1,105 @@ + + + + + + + + + {{ name }} + Serving {{ files.length }} files + + + + + + + + + + + + + + + + + + + + diff --git a/src/site/views/dashboard/Albums.vue b/src/site/views/dashboard/Albums.vue index 2c7984c..57cd01f 100644 --- a/src/site/views/dashboard/Albums.vue +++ b/src/site/views/dashboard/Albums.vue @@ -211,7 +211,7 @@ - {{ props.row.identifier }} @@ -235,10 +235,11 @@ - - {{ props.row.createdAt }} + Delete link @@ -251,11 +252,11 @@ - - Create new link - + Create new link + {{ album.links.length }} / {{ config.maxLinksPerAlbum }} links created @@ -285,6 +286,11 @@ export default { newAlbumName: null }; }, + computed: { + config() { + return this.$store.state.config; + } + }, metaInfo() { return { title: 'Uploads' }; }, -- cgit v1.2.3
- Create new link -